TL;DR

Keyword gap analysis helps you to identify keywords your competitors rank for, but you don’t. It reveals untapped opportunities, helps close content gaps, and strengthens your visibility in SERPs. In this guide, you’ll learn what keyword gap analysis is, why it matters for SEO, how to do it, and which tools to use.

Competitor Gap Analysis - How is it Different from Keyword Gap Analysis

Competitor and keyword gap analyses are closely related but serve different purposes within your SEO strategy.

While the latter focuses specifically on identifying the keywords your competitors rank for, but you don’t, competitor gap analysis takes a broader approach. It assesses overall digital performance gaps, including backlinks, content quality, on-page SEO, technical health, and even social/brand visibility.

How to Do Keyword Gap Analysis (Step-by-Step)

If you’re wondering what keyword gap analysis is or how to turn insights into action, this step-by-step guide walks you through the exact process. Whether you’re targeting traditional rankings or optimising for AI search and LLM citations, mastering the gap between your site and competitors is crucial.

Step 1 – Identify Your Top Competitors

For the gap analysis, you must start by identifying who you’re competing with, not just your business rivals. Your focus must be on commercial competition, meaning companies that are directly in line with your business from a similar products/services standpoint and (or) running in a similar geographic location. Another way to identify them is by selecting brands that are competing organically.

Tools like SEMrush/Ahrefs Keyword Gaps Tool can simplify your process.

Step 2 – Collect Keyword Data

The following steps get easier after you’ve listed 3 to 5 top SEO competitors. Now, focus on their ranking keywords and export both organic keywords and those appearing in featured snippets or AI-powered summaries.

Step 3 – Compare Keyword Sets

Compare your keyword sets with those of your competitors and identify search terms that your site is missing. The core of keyword gap analysis is to reveal where you lack visibility. Therefore, your goal must be to isolate exclusive keywords your site doesn’t rank for.

Common Mistakes to Avoid in Keyword Gap Analysis

Even with the best tools at your disposal, simple oversights can limit your impact. Some common pitfalls can easily reduce the value of your overall analysis, especially when trying to optimise for AI-driven search and GEO.

Only Looking at Volume, Not Intent

Don’t make the mistake of prioritising keywords with the highest search volume. Your keyword gap analysis needs a more nuanced approach. LLMs and generative engines care deeply about context and intent. A lower-volume keyword with informational or transactional relevance may be far more valuable for AI citations than a high-volume, broad term.

Ignoring Long-Tail Opportunities

Long-tail keywords are often where true content gaps lie, especially for conversational queries used in LLMS or Google AI Overviews. If you ignore these, you miss out on low-competition, high-relevance terms that are more likely to surface in AI-generated summaries.

Not Updating the Analysis Regularly

Again, a gap analysis isn’t a one-time audit. New keywords, SERP features, and AI answer formats emerge constantly. If you’re not refreshing your strategy around competitor keyword gaps at least monthly, you risk falling behind on terms your rivals are newly ranking for—or those that LLMs are now retrieving.

Best Practices to Maximise Keyword Gap Insights

Keyword gap analysis is just the beginning. What happens next is the most essential part of your on-page SEO strategy. You have to extract real strategic value from the captured data and generate content around it.

When done right, the following practices can help you turn raw keyword data into action plans so your website can climb up the ranking and search visibility ladder.

1.  Map Gaps to Topic Clusters or Pillars

Don’t plug keyword gaps in isolation. Instead, group them into topic clusters supporting your broader content pillars.

This increases your organic rankings and chances of your website being cited by LLMs. It is also rewarding from the standpoint of comprehensive topical coverage.

2. Align Keywords with Funnel Stages

Map each gap keyword to the specific stage in the buyer journey, aka TOFU (awareness), MOFU (consideration), and BOFU (decision).

This way, you can target customers at every stage while making your content more contextually relevant for AI engines parsing intent-rich prompts.

3. Combine with Content & Technical Audits

Keyword gaps often reveal more than missing topics; they expose content decay, poor structure, or slow page speed. Integrate your findings from the keyword gap analysis with broader content and technical audits to uncover underperformance across the board. Then, fix both ranking and retrieval issues.

FAQs

1. What is keyword gap analysis in SEO?
Keyword gap analysis in SEO refers to the process of identifying keywords that your competitors are ranking for, but your website isn’t. It highlights content opportunities that can help you close visibility gaps, improve rankings, and appear more frequently in AI-generated search summaries.

2. How do I do a keyword gap analysis?
To perform keyword gap analysis, you can start by identifying your top-ranking competitors, discovering the keywords you aren’t ranking for, prioritising and optimising (or creating) content around missed topics/keywords.

3. What is the benefit of SEO keyword gap analysis?
The primary benefit of SEO keyword gap analysis is uncovering untapped opportunities for visibility and traffic. It helps you to stay competitive, relevant, and visible on AI-powered search engines.

4. Are keyword gap analysis tools free?
Some keyword gap analysis tools offer limited free features (e.g., Google Search Console, The HOTH), but most comprehensive solutions like SEMrush, Ahrefs, or SE Ranking require a paid subscription.
